Vineyard & Vintage
Handpicked from low-yielding vines at just 3 tonnes per hectare, the 2021 vintage benefited from optimal vintage conditions. Spring’s generous rainfall and cooler summer temperatures ensured healthy vine growth, while a dry late summer fostered exceptional ripeness. This resulted in a fuller-bodied wine with vibrant phenolic concentration, standing out from previous vintages.
Vinification & Ageing
Glaetzer Bishop 2021 undergoes fermentation in small 1 and 2 tonne open fermenters with extended maceration, encouraging soft tannin development for early drinkability. The wine is carefully matured for 16 months in a blend of 40% new French and American oak barrels and 60% seasoned hogsheads, imparting complexity and smooth texture.
Tasting Notes
This vintage presents a vibrant dark red colour with purple hues. The bouquet opens with enticing aromas of black cherry and dried spices. On the palate, enjoy layered flavours of ripe black cherry, raspberry, olive, and black pepper, all balanced by fine tannins. The wine is full-bodied, smooth, and finishes persistently, perfect for pairing with hearty grilled meats, rich pasta dishes, or aged cheeses.

Glaetzer Wines is a boutique, family-owned winery in Australia’s Barossa Valley, renowned for producing premium old vine Shiraz and Cabernet Sauvignon wines. Established in 1995, the winery continues a winemaking legacy that dates back to the late 1800s, when the Glaetzer family emigrated from Germany and became some of the first viticulturalists in both the Barossa Valley and Clare Valley.
Today, Glaetzer Wines is led by award-winning winemaker Ben Glaetzer, whose philosophy blends traditional techniques with modern precision. All fruit is hand-selected from the Ebenezer sub-region in the northern Barossa, a site famous for its dry-grown, non-grafted bush vines aged between 80 and 110 years. These ancient vines produce low yields of intensely flavoured grapes, forming the backbone of Glaetzer’s bold and expressive wines.
In the cellar, Ben practices minimal intervention winemaking, allowing the unique terroir of Barossa to shine through. Every wine is crafted in small batches to maintain quality and site expression.
Glaetzer's flagship wines, including the iconic Amon-Ra Shiraz and the Anaperenna Shiraz Cabernet blend, have gained global recognition for their depth, balance, and unmistakable Barossa character.
